The Physical Therapy Medical Receptionist will work at the front desk of our physical therapy office and assist our patients and other visitors. The primary job duties include greeting and checking-in patients, answering questions, collecting patient co-pays, and processing paperwork.
Essential Responsibilities:
- Greet patients and visitors, check in patients, verify insurance
- Collect Co-pay
- Follows all Connecticut Orthopedic Specialists P.C. policies and procedures include but not limited to human resources, clinic, administrative, HIPAA and compliance
- Enter patient demographics and insurance information into the Electronic Medical Record
- Determine fees and process appropriate copayments, properly record information
- Maintain appropriate levels of cash and balance cash drawer according to procedure
- Performs other duties as assigned by their supervisor
